How UPS Air Cargo Tracking Works

The tracking process begins when a shipment is prepared for dispatch, generating a unique tracking number. This number is crucial as it allows both the sender and recipient to monitor the shipment’s progress from origin to destination. UPS provides real-time updates at various stages, including pickup, transit, customs clearance (for international shipments), and final delivery.

Step-by-Step Guide to Tracking UPS Air Cargo

Tracking your UPS air cargo is straightforward. First, obtain the tracking number from your shipment receipt or confirmation email. You can then enter this number on the UPS website’s tracking page or in the UPS mobile app. The platform will display the current status, location, and expected delivery time of your shipment. For businesses, third-party tools can also be integrated for more sophisticated tracking needs.

UPS Air Cargo Tracking via Website

To track your cargo via the UPS website, start by navigating to the UPS tracking page. Enter your tracking number in the designated field, and click “Track.” The system will pull up the latest information on your shipment, including its current status, any delays, and the expected delivery date.

UPS Air Cargo Tracking via Mobile App

The UPS mobile app offers a convenient way to track your air cargo on the go. After downloading and installing the app, log in or create a UPS account. Enter your tracking number into the app’s interface to view your shipment’s status. The app also allows you to set up push notifications for real-time updates and alerts.

Common Issues with UPS Air Cargo Tracking

While UPS strives for accuracy in its tracking system, issues can occasionally arise. Common problems include tracking numbers not working, delays in tracking updates, and sometimes misleading status updates that can cause confusion. These issues can often be resolved with a few simple steps or by contacting UPS customer support.

Solutions to Tracking Issues

If you encounter problems with your tracking number, ensure you’ve entered it correctly. For delayed updates, consider that some locations may not update as frequently due to logistical reasons. Misleading status updates often result from system errors and usually correct themselves within a short time. If these issues persist, contacting UPS support is the best course of action.

FAQs on UPS Air Cargo Tracking

  • Why is my UPS Air Cargo tracking not updating?
    Tracking updates may be delayed due to logistical reasons or system errors. It often resolves within a few hours.
  • Can I track multiple cargo shipments at once?
    Yes, UPS allows tracking of multiple shipments through their website or mobile app.
  • What does “In Transit” mean on UPS tracking?
    “In Transit” indicates that your shipment is on its way to the destination but has not yet been delivered.
  • How do I obtain a tracking number for my UPS air cargo?
    The tracking number is provided at the time of shipment, usually via email or on your receipt.
  • What should I do if my tracking number isn’t recognized?
    Double-check the number for any errors. If it still isn’t recognized, contact UPS support for assistance.
  • Are there any additional fees for using UPS air cargo tracking?
    No, tracking is included in the service at no additional cost.
